We invite applications for a fully funded three-year postdoctoral position in Cognitive Neuroscience at Adam Mickiewicz University (AMU, PI: Rafał Jończyk), Poznań, Poland, within a research project entitled "Creativity and bilingualism: How neural signatures of creative idea generation and evaluation resonate in the native and second language" and funded by the National Science Center (2024/54/E/HS6/00066).
The successful candidate will join an exciting research project investigating the neural mechanisms underlying creative idea generation and evaluation in bilinguals, combining behavioral methods with cutting-edge neurophysiological techniques. The project aims to advance our understanding of how bilingual experience influences creative cognition and the brain processes that support the generation and evaluation of novel ideas.
The project will be carried out at the Psychophysiology of Language and Affect (PoLA) Lab (PI: Rafał Jończyk) at Adam Mickiewicz University (https://pola.amu.edu.pl/) in collaboration with Prof. Guillaume Thierry (Bangor University, UK). The postdoc will have opportunities for international collaboration and research visits.
The PoLA Lab is part of the Cognitive Neuroscience Center: https://neuroscience.amu.edu.pl/. The lab is equipped with state-of-the-art psychophysiological research infrastructure, including two 64-channel BioSemi EEG systems (with GSR sensors) enabling dual-EEG/hyperscanning studies in adjacent testing booths. Additional facilities include access to eye-tracking, fNIRS, tDCS, and TMS.

Project description:
Can we differentiate the neural signatures of creative idea generation from those of evaluation? Do people evaluate their own ideas differently from those of others? And finally – in bilinguals, does the language in which they think differentiate the way ideas are generated and evaluated?
Creativity – the uniquely human capacity to generate novel and contextually appropriate ideas – underlies human innovation and problem-solving. Research to date has focused mainly on idea generation (what happens when people come up with ideas), with far less attention paid to idea evaluation (what happens when people perceive an idea as creative or not) – even though both processes are equally important. Moreover, given the growing multilingualism of today's world, it is worth examining whether and how the creative process differs between a bilingual's two languages. This project is the first attempt to characterize the neural signatures of generating and evaluating creative ideas in both a person's native language and their second language.
Across six experiments, we will apply state-of-the-art neuroscientific and statistical methods (including time-frequency analysis and hierarchical linear modeling of EEG data) with Polish-English bilingual participants performing creative problem-solving tasks in their native language (L1, Polish) and second language (L2, English). We will first develop a rigorously controlled set of problems and track the evaluation of creativity through modulations of event-related potentials (ERPs) in response to solutions varying in originality and effectiveness. We will then engage participants in a novel two-stage problem-solving task that forces dynamic switching between idea generation and evaluation – both within individual trials and across experimental blocks – in order to characterize the interplay between the two processes at the neurophysiological level. In the block-based version of this paradigm, we will also conduct the first comparison of the evaluation of one's own ideas versus those of others using neurophysiological measures. Once refined, these paradigms will serve as the foundation for our final experiments investigating the interactions between idea generation, idea evaluation, and language of operation in Polish-English bilinguals. These goals will be pursued by a dedicated, interdisciplinary, and international team assembled specifically for this project.
Our project will push the boundaries of knowledge on the relationship between the generation and evaluation of creative ideas in a native versus second language, making a significant contribution to the rapidly developing field of the neuroscience of creativity. We also believe its findings may have practical significance. Understanding creative problem-solving is crucial today – complex, fast-changing challenges such as environmental pollution or global health crises require innovative and flexible solutions. Understanding the role of language(s) in this process could, in turn, lead to concrete recommendations and even inform policy-making in international settings where multilingualism is increasingly becoming the norm.
